Dont have any actual "installation" pics but here is my suspension and body lifts.

This is the 3" lift from CALMINI that I installed.

Front shocks, new upper control arms, and new ball joints. I also got new torsion bars with the kit

The new blocks which put the rear end at an angle so the drive-shaft isn't strained but gives me alot of axel wrap, rear shocks, u-bolts, and brake-line extensions(the E-Brake cable is still to tight on the leaf spring), and rear bump-stop extensions

New and longer rear shackles (Took off to bring the front end up and level the truck out)

These are some of the things I had to do for the 3" AC Body Lift.

Weld on 4 bed supports

Extend GAS LINE and install STEERING EXTENSION

Custom made UPPER RADIATOR DROP BRACKETS to keep the radiator level with the fan. The ones in the kit were to much of a pain to put on so I made these simply by cutting and flipping over the stock brackets. Works great.
